class ZeroconfProvider(mcg.Base):
SIGNAL_SERVICE_NEW = 'service-new'
TYPE = '_mpd._tcp'
def __init__(self):
mcg.Base.__init__(self)
self._service_resolvers = []
self._services = {}
# Client
self._client = Avahi.Client(flags=0,)
self._client.start()
# Browser
self._service_browser = Avahi.ServiceBrowser(domain='local', flags=0, interface=-1, protocol=Avahi.Protocol.GA_PROTOCOL_UNSPEC, type=ZeroconfProvider.TYPE)
self._service_browser.connect('new_service', self.on_new_service)
self._service_browser.attach(self._client)
def on_new_service(self, browser, interface, protocol, name, type, domain, flags):
if not (flags & Avahi.LookupResultFlags.GA_LOOKUP_RESULT_LOCAL):
service_resolver = Avahi.ServiceResolver(interface=interface, protocol=protocol, name=name, type=type, domain=domain, aprotocol=Avahi.Protocol.GA_PROTOCOL_UNSPEC, flags=0,)
service_resolver.connect('found', self.on_found)
service_resolver.connect('failure', self.on_failure)
service_resolver.attach(self._client)
self._service_resolvers.append(service_resolver)
def on_found(self, resolver, interface, protocol, name, type, domain, host, date, port, *args):
if (host, port) not in self._services.keys():
service = (name,host,port)
self._services[(host,port)] = service
self._callback(ZeroconfProvider.SIGNAL_SERVICE_NEW, service)
def on_failure(self, resolver, date):
if resolver in self._service_resolvers:
self._service_resolvers.remove(resolver)
